What Is NAP in SEO
In the world of local search engine optimization, NAP stands for Name, Address, and Phone number. It refers to the core contact information that identifies your business across the internet, from your own website to directories, review sites, social profiles, and map listings. While it may seem like a trivial detail, NAP consistency is one of the most influential factors in how well a local business ranks in search results and appears in the map pack.
Search engines use NAP data to verify that a business is real, established, and trustworthy. When your information matches everywhere it appears, search engines gain confidence in your legitimacy, which supports stronger local rankings.

Why NAP Consistency Matters
Imagine a search engine finding your business listed as ABC Plumbing at 123 Main Street with one phone number on your website, but as ABC Plumbing Co. at 123 Main St with a slightly different number on a directory. These discrepancies create doubt. Search engines cannot be certain the listings refer to the same business, which weakens the trust signals your business relies on to rank. Even minor variations, such as Street versus St or an old phone number left on a forgotten profile, can add up to real ranking damage.
Consistency, on the other hand, reinforces confidence. When every mention of your business matches precisely, search engines can confidently associate all those citations with a single, credible entity, boosting your authority in local results.
NAP and Local Search Rankings
Local search rankings are heavily influenced by relevance, distance, and prominence. NAP consistency feeds directly into prominence, which reflects how well-known and trusted your business is online. Accurate citations across authoritative directories signal that your business is legitimate and active. This is especially important for appearing in the local map pack, the coveted block of three business listings that appears above traditional results for local queries.
Businesses with clean, consistent NAP data tend to dominate these positions, while those with scattered or conflicting information struggle to appear at all. In competitive local markets, this can be the deciding factor between a full appointment book and an empty one.
Where Your NAP Appears
Your NAP shows up in more places than most business owners realize. It appears on your website, your Google Business Profile, major directories like Yelp and Bing Places, industry-specific listings, social media profiles, and countless data aggregators that feed information to other platforms. Each of these represents a citation, and each citation is an opportunity to either reinforce or undermine your consistency. Common NAP Problems
Several issues commonly plague business NAP data. Duplicate listings can appear when a business is accidentally added to a directory more than once, splitting reviews and confusing search engines. Outdated information lingers when a business moves or changes its phone number but forgets to update older profiles. Formatting inconsistencies, such as abbreviating words differently, create subtle mismatches. Even suite numbers and floor designations need to be handled consistently. Left unchecked, these problems accumulate and quietly erode your local search engine optimization performance.
How to Maintain NAP Consistency
Maintaining consistent NAP data starts with choosing a single, canonical format for your business information and using it everywhere without deviation. Audit your existing citations to find and fix discrepancies, claim and verify your listings on major platforms, and remove or merge any duplicates. When your business details change, update every profile promptly rather than only the most visible ones. Ongoing monitoring is essential, since new inaccurate listings can appear over time through automated data feeds.
